Hi everyone,

 

I normally attach my ribbon at the base of the cake and just wanted to see the best way of attaching it as in the picture.  How do you lovely ladies secure the ribbon pinched together in the middle, the bit under the brooch?

 

Thanks for your help!

You could sew it pinched, or melt it together, and attach with a bit of royal.
